The Legend of Perseus, Volume 2 (of 3) is a classic book written by Edwin Sidney Hartland. This book is part of a three-volume series that delves into the ancient Greek myth of Perseus, the legendary hero known for slaying the Gorgon Medusa. In this second volume, Hartland continues to explore the epic saga of Perseus' adventures, picking up where the first volume left off.
Hartland's writing style is thorough and detailed, providing readers with a comprehensive understanding of the myth of Perseus. He carefully examines the various versions of the myth found in ancient texts and offers his own interpretations and insights.
